Unlock Unparalleled Career Opportunities
German ranks among the top business languages globally. Countries like Germany, Austria, and Switzerland sit among Europe’s strongest economies and major hubs in science, engineering, and innovation. Speaking German sets you apart in industries such as automotive, engineering, pharmaceuticals, and renewable energy. Language is culture, and German culture is rich with philosophy, art, literature, and science. Reading Goethe or Kafka in their original language reveals layers hidden in translation. You’ll appreciate German traditions, witty humor, and philosophical depth in a way never before possible. Connect authentically with native speakers—whether traveling across Germany, Austria, or Switzerland, or engaging online communities—your effort to learn German builds trust, respect, and meaningful relationships.

How to Start: Begin Your German Journey in Minutes
The best part? You don’t need 10 minutes of focused study daily to begin. Start now:
- Listen: Use German podcasts, music, or news snippets during your commute.
- Speak: Practice phrases with language apps like Duolingo or Tandem.
- Read: Explore short German articles, children’s books, or social media.
- Connect: Join online German learning communities to immerse yourself.
